Frequently asked questions about cabins in Loch Awe

  • What are some under-the-radar gems to discover in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    For a truly off-the-beaten-track experience near Loch Awe, explore Kilchurn Castle's less-visited areas. The surrounding woodland trails offer stunning views and a peaceful escape. Another hidden gem is the small village of Dalmally, with its charming pubs and the nearby Falls of Cruachan. Consider a hike to the summit of Ben Cruachan for breathtaking panoramic views of the loch and surrounding countryside. Finally, explore the less-frequented parts of the Loch Awe shoreline by kayak or canoe for a unique perspective.

  • What should you consider packing specifically for a trip to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    Pack for all types of weather in Loch Awe. Layers are essential, including waterproof and windproof outerwear, fleeces, and warm jumpers. Good walking boots are a must for exploring the hills and trails around the loch. Don't forget insect repellent, especially during the summer months. A waterproof bag for your valuables is also recommended, as is sunscreen and a hat for sunny days.

  • What wildlife can be spotted near cabins in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    Depending on the location of your cabin, you might spot red deer, particularly in the forests around the loch. Various bird species are common, including ospreys, herons, and various ducks. You may also see rabbits, and occasionally, otters along the shoreline. Remember to maintain a respectful distance from all wildlife.

  • When is the most favourable weather for outdoor activities in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    The months of June to August generally offer the best weather for outdoor activities in Loch Awe, with warmer temperatures and longer daylight hours. However, even during these months, be prepared for changeable conditions, so layers are always recommended.

  • What are the must-visit natural attractions in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    Kilchurn Castle, perched dramatically on the lochside, is a must-see. The Falls of Cruachan offer a stunning display of cascading water. For hiking enthusiasts, Ben Cruachan provides breathtaking views. Exploring the loch itself by boat is also highly recommended, allowing you to appreciate its beauty and discover hidden coves.

  • What local meals should be on my list while visiting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    Sample some fresh local seafood at one of the pubs or restaurants in the area. Look out for dishes featuring Scottish salmon or trout. Many establishments also offer traditional Scottish dishes like haggis, neeps, and tatties. Don't forget to try a local whisky at a traditional pub.
  • Is there anything unique that you should pack for a visit to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    A good pair of binoculars would be a worthwhile addition to your luggage, allowing you to fully appreciate the abundant birdlife and potentially spot some red deer from a distance. A waterproof map of the area is also useful for exploring the varied terrain around the loch.
  • What’s the recommended duration for an immersive visit to Loch Awe, United Kingdom?

    A long weekend (3-4 days) allows for a good exploration of Loch Awe and its surroundings, including visiting Kilchurn Castle, hiking Ben Cruachan, and enjoying the loch itself. However, a week-long stay would provide more time for leisurely activities and deeper exploration of the area’s hidden gems.
